inflation is the rate at which prices in an economy rise. the inflation rate in the united states versus its trade partners has an inverse connection with currency depreciation or appreciation. higher inflation depreciates currency relative to lower inflation because inflation indicates that the cost of goods and services rises. those commodities are then more expensive for other countries to acquire. rising prices may reduce demand. imported goods, on the other hand, become more appealing to buyers in higher inflation countries.
